Global Block Model

A global tectonic block model providing internally consistent fault slip rates derived from joint inversion of geodetic and geologic data, developed to support probabilistic seismic hazard assessment.

Description

The GEM Global Block Model is a research dataset that contains a comprehensive, globally complete set of >7000 active faults, combined with a subdivision of the entire Earth surface into ~2000 tectonic plates or microplates (blocks), and a set of three-dimensional meshes of subduction interfaces. 


The faults are boundaries between blocks, and the slip rates of the faults (proportional to the seismic activity of the faults) are determined by the relative motion of the blocks on either side of the faults. The fault geometries are from a near-complete remapping of Earth’s deforming regions, based in part on existing mapping (such as the previous version of the GEM Global Active Faults Database or GEM GAF-DB), as well as interpretations of high-resolution topography, seismicity and geodetic data, to maximize completeness, accuracy, and mapping style specifically for seismic hazard assessment. 


The block motions are determined through joint inversion of geodetic velocity data — primarily GNSS observations supplemented by InSAR-derived velocity fields from the COMET LiCSAR processing system — and geologic fault slip rates spanning decadal to Quaternary timescales. The primary output is the set of active faults with complete, internally-consistent slip rates and formal uncertainties, and subduction interfaces with spatially-variable coupling estimated simultaneously with the slip rates. 


These fault data may be easily used to build and evaluate seismic source models using the OpenQuake software suite. The GEM Global Block Model is a work in progress, and both block geometries and derived fault parameters are subject to revision as new geodetic and geologic data are incorporated.
